a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orwhitequark <whitequark@whitequark.org>2020-12-28 02:33:30 +0000
committerGitHub <noreply@github.com>2020-12-28 02:33:30 +0000
commitf4a800899cd6424c852df6922628e2600a9a3978 (patch)
tree006f7b1eeb846f63cea9da1852377f18bdea4ad6
parentf48298347cc01d538e20dd9d86b4f795780f8f1d (diff)
parent16c4182c74f7898ae6e3c7cbac8a29d8cc8e5510 (diff)
downloadyosys-f4a800899cd6424c852df6922628e2600a9a3978.tar.gz
yosys-f4a800899cd6424c852df6922628e2600a9a3978.tar.bz2
yosys-f4a800899cd6424c852df6922628e2600a9a3978.zip
Merge pull request #2507 from umarcor/fix/msys2
kernel/yosys.h: undef CONST on WIN32
-rw-r--r--kernel/yosys.h5
1 files changed, 3 insertions, 2 deletions
diff --git a/kernel/yosys.h b/kernel/yosys.h
index ac4436c52..43aecdbc8 100644
--- a/kernel/yosys.h
+++ b/kernel/yosys.h
@@ -121,8 +121,9 @@ extern Tcl_Obj *Tcl_ObjSetVar2(Tcl_Interp *interp, Tcl_Obj *part1Ptr, Tcl_Obj *p
# define fileno _fileno
# endif
-// mingw and msvc include `wingdi.h` which defines a TRANSPARENT macro
-// that conflicts with X(TRANSPARENT) entry in kernel/constids.inc
+// The following defines conflict with our identifiers:
+# undef CONST
+// `wingdi.h` defines a TRANSPARENT macro that conflicts with X(TRANSPARENT) entry in kernel/constids.inc
# undef TRANSPARENT
#endif